Company: Americas Styrenics
Current Parent Company:
Americas Styrenics
Parent at the Time of the Penalty Announcement:
subscribe to see this data field
Penalty: $7,000
Year: 2010
Date: May 6, 2010
Offense Group: safety-related offenses
Primary Offense: railroad safety violation
Level of Government: federal
Action Type: agency action
Agency: Federal Railroad Administration
Civil or Criminal Case: civil
HQ Country of Current Parent: USA
HQ State of Current Parent: Texas
Ownership Structure of Current Parent: joint venture (owned 50-50 by Trinseo and Chevron Phillips Chemical)
Major Industry of Current Parent: chemicals
Specific Industry of Current Parent: chemicals
